Deep cleaning teeth is fundamentally different from the preventive cleaning most patients receive twice a year: it targets the bacterial calculus deposits that have accumulated on tooth root surfaces below the gumline, inside periodontal pockets that have deepened beyond the healthy threshold of 3mm. Left untreated, these deposits drive ongoing gum inflammation, bone destruction, and eventually tooth loss. The good news is that when treated promptly with scaling and root planing, the vast majority of patients with moderate gum disease achieve stable, improved gum health β often without ever needing surgical intervention. A complete deep cleaning teeth service in Mount Vernon should include all of the following: a full periodontal charting session before treatment begins; digital radiographs to evaluate bone levels and root anatomy; administration of local anesthesia per quadrant as a standard (non-optional) component; ultrasonic scaling to remove the bulk of calculus above and below the gumline; hand scaling and root planing to complete calculus removal and smooth root surfaces; a written copy of post-operative instructions; a scheduled re-evaluation appointment at four to six weeks post-treatment; and a clear plan for transitioning to periodontal maintenance (three-to-four-month visits) once healing is confirmed. Some Mount Vernon providers additionally offer: locally applied antibiotic therapy for persistent deep pockets; laser-assisted scaling as an adjunct to traditional instruments; and same-day digital periodontal charting with computerized tracking for precise monitoring over time. Here's what Mount Vernon residents in the area need to know: How Dental Insurance Covers Deep Cleaning: Most dental plans categorize SRP as a "major" or "basic-major" periodontal service and cover it at 50β80% after the annual deductible. The procedure is billed under CDT codes D4341 (per quadrant, 4+ teeth) or D4342 (per quadrant, 1β3 teeth). Request a pre-authorization letter from your insurer before scheduling treatment β this protects you from unexpected bill amounts. Kentucky Medicaid: Adult dental coverage under KY Medicaid varies. Can deep cleaning teeth in Mount Vernon, KY improve bad breath?
Yes β one of the most immediate and noticeable benefits of deep cleaning teeth in Mount Vernon, KY for many patients is a significant improvement in breath freshness. Persistent halitosis (bad breath) that does not resolve with brushing, flossing, and mouthwash is frequently caused by the anaerobic bacteria living in subgingival periodontal pockets. These bacteria produce volatile sulfur compounds (VSCs) as metabolic byproducts β compounds with the characteristic unpleasant odor associated with gum disease. Standard mouth rinses and surface cleaning cannot eliminate the source of these odors because they cannot reach below the gumline where the bacteria colonies reside. Scaling and root planing targets precisely that subgingival environment β removing the calculus that anchors bacterial biofilm to root surfaces and disrupting the bacterial ecosystem responsible for chronic odor production. Most patients in the area of Mount Vernon, County who complete scaling and root planing report a noticeable improvement in breath freshness within one to two weeks of treatment, as the bacterial load in periodontal pockets decreases and gum inflammation begins to resolve. What is the ADA recommendation for deep cleaning teeth frequency in Mount Vernon, KY?
The American Dental Association (ADA) and the American Academy of Periodontology (AAP) both recognize deep cleaning teeth (scaling and root planing) as the evidence-based first-line non-surgical treatment for periodontal disease. Regarding frequency: the initial full-mouth deep cleaning is prescribed once when active gum disease is diagnosed β it is not an annual service like a preventive cleaning. After the initial treatment is completed and healing is confirmed at the re-evaluation visit, patients transition to periodontal maintenance β a specialized cleaning protocol recommended every three to four months based on research showing bacterial recolonization of pockets within 90 days. This maintenance schedule, rather than repeat full-mouth deep cleaning, is the ongoing standard. If, despite regular maintenance, pocket depths worsen again at a specific site, localized additional scaling may be performed at that maintenance visit β but a full repeat of scaling and root planing across all quadrants is not a routine expectation for patients who maintain diligent home care.
